The application period for the competitive “alternate route” process for attending the Gloucester County Police Academy has opened with the application deadline set for Friday, September 14, 2018. The actual exam is scheduled to be administered Wednesday, October 3rd, 2018

The Gloucester County Police Academy released the following information:

The Alternate Route Program allows civilians to sponsor themselves through the academy and is open to those who have completed ALL of the following:

  1. 60 College Credits by the end of the Fall 2018 semester from a regionally accredited school with a minimum GPA of 2.00 at the time of application. The 2.00 minimum GPA requirement is applicable to all college students, regardless of the number of credits they have earned at the time of application, OR
  2. Two years full-time active military service by December 31, 2018. This now may be substituted for the requirement of 60 college

All initial applications must be received by the Gloucester County Police Academy, 1400 Tanyard Road, Sewell, New Jersey, no later than September 14, 2018, at 4:00 p.m.  A head and shoulders photograph must be attached to the initial application. Additionally, provide the following attachments:

    1. If you are an applicant with 60 college credits, provide  the academy  with  your  current  official  transcript. If you won’t achieve your 60 college credits until December 2018, include a transcript showing the credits you have obtained thus far. Note: any remedial credit classes do not count toward the total of 60 college credits. No copies of  college  degrees  will  be accepted in lieu of an official transcript.
    2. If you are an applicant with at least two years full-time active military service, you must attach a copy of your DD214 to your application. If you have college credits in addition to your military experience, provide the academy with a current official transcript as well.
    3. Guidelines for photographs: Your photograph must be a color photograph taken within the last 60 days. Photographs should not exceed 4″ X 3″ and should be strictly a head and shoulders shot against a plain background. No props or hats are permitted. Applicants should be properly clothed and think of the photo as one to be submitted with a job application.
    4. $40.00 NON-REFUNDABLE application fee. Applicants must enclose a money order or cashier’s check payable to Gloucester County Police Academy when submitting the application. Personal checks or cash will not be accepted.

Any initial applications without the required attachments will not be accepted and will be returned immediately. Once again, unofficial transcripts are not acceptable, and the required official transcript must accompany your submitted paperwork. The police academy will not accept a transcript mailed to us separately from the rest of the application package, so keep this in mind when ordering transcripts. Have your official transcript sent to you directly, not the police academy. If feasible, it is in your best interest to go directly to your college to pick up your transcript.

After the application deadline, all eligible applicants who return this document with all required attachments will receive an email invitation to participate in phase one of the selection process, the written examination, which will be conducted at 1:00 p.m. on Wednesday, October 3, 2018 in a location on campus to be determined. If you do not report for the test, YOU WILL NOT BE ABLE TO CONTINUE THE APPLICATION PROCESS. MAKE-UP TESTS WILL NOT BE GIVEN. Individuals who pass the written test will be invited to take a physical fitness assessment to be held on a Saturday in mid to late October, at 7:30 a.m. More details will follow.

Bear in mind that this is a daytime program costing approximately $1,800 to accepted candidates.
